Love For Argyle Sweater 2 pattern by Marjolijn Reuter

This raglan sweater has a 12 cm ease, is nice and long and super soft. It was knitted holding two yarns together throughout the whole patter. There are 4 panels (the front panel has an Argyle pattern that is knitted in intarsia) that will be sewn together with the blanket stitch at the end. Each pattern size has its customized pattern parts (on graph paper) to fit its front, back and sleeve panels. Sizes: S (M) L Bust circumference: 85-90 (90-95) 95-100 Measurements sweater: Chest plus ease: 102 (107) 112 cm Width front panel: 51 (53.5) 56 cm Length mid back: 60 (64) 65 cm Sleeve length: 69 (71) 73 cm Needles: 1 pair each 4 mm (US 6) and 4.5 mm (US 7) strait single pointed needles. One 4 mm circular needles 50 cm. One 4.5 mm cable stitch holder, one tapestry needle bent point and a measuring tape in centimeters. Gauge: 21 st x 26 rows = 10 x 10 cm on 4.5 mm needles, knitted in pattern, after blocking. Materials: This pattern is knitted using 3 colors.
